Every last Sunday of October, the medieval village of Noyers-sur-Serein (89310) comes alive to the rhythm of the Burgundy truffle. The Truffle Market, organized by the Confraternity of the Burgundy Truffle of Noyers, is one of the most important truffle events in the region, bringing together producers, restaurateurs, gourmets, and the curious around the black jewel of the Burgundian undergrowth.
The Burgundy truffle (Tuber uncinatum), also known as the Saint-Jean truffle or Christmas truffle, is a distinct species from the Périgord truffle. Its hazelnut-brown flesh, its aromas of wild mushrooms, hazelnuts, and undergrowth make it a highly prized product for enthusiasts. It is harvested from October to December in the oak and hazel groves of the Yonne and neighboring departments, on limestone soils conducive to its development.
Burgundy, and the Yonne in particular, are among the most productive and recognized truffle lands for this species. The Confraternity of the Burgundy Truffle of Noyers has been dedicated for years to the promotion and enhancement of this local product of excellence.

Noyers-sur-Serein is an architectural gem of southern Burgundy. Surrounded by its largely intact 14th-century medieval ramparts, the village boasts half-timbered houses and Renaissance mansions around a picturesque central square. Classified among the Most Beautiful Villages in France, it offers an incomparable setting for the Truffle Festival, whose aromas seem to blend naturally into the timeless atmosphere of the cobbled streets.

The Fête de la Truffe de Bourgogne in Noyers-sur-Serein returns on the last Sunday of October 2026 for its grand annual market. The Confraternity of the Burgundy Truffle is once again organizing this flagship event for gourmets from the Yonne and Burgundy in the incomparable medieval setting of Noyers' ramparts.
From 8 am at the town hall, certified inspectors will check the truffles one by one, guaranteeing the quality and authenticity of the Tuber uncinatum offered for sale. At 10:30 am, the auction sale, launched to the sound of the horn, will bring together producers and buyers. The traditional giant truffle omelette will be offered to visitors present, while stalls of local producers, winemakers, and artisans will complete this day of flavors and conviviality in one of the Most Beautiful Villages in France.
Truffle inspection from 8 am at the town hall. Auction sale from 10:30 am until stocks are depleted.
Free entry. Truffle prices vary depending on quality and harvest.
